Taxi bosses down tools after Eastern Cape fails to pay for scholar transport
By Anita Dangazele Operators say unpaid invoices left them unable to pay drivers, buy fuel, renew licences or service vehicles for learner transport. Transport MEC Xolile Nqatha apologised and said the scholar transport budget falls short of what the province needs.
